Where is the evac vent valve solenoid on a 2000 Pontiac Montana?

The vent valve is mounted underneath the vehicle in around the center point right next to the vapor canister (enclosed in metal box) mounted on same bracket that holds the canister.

How do you replace the Evaporative Emission Canister Purge Solenoid Valve on a 2001 Buick century custom?

Fault code: P 0446. The valve is located behind the fender and beside the gas fill pipe. Jack up the rear of the car. Remove the hose and wire harness. Below the valve is a metal bracket support bolt. Remove it. The bracket should then slide out towards the rear of the vehicle. After the bracket is removed put a flat screwdriver into the middle of the bracket support to release solenoid, (note where the valve is located on the bracket for the new solenoid position).

Where is the vent solenoid on a 2004 Sierra?

The vent valve is mounted on a bracket near the fuel tank. Disconnect the electrical connector. Remove the hose from the vent valve then release the retainers and remove the vent valve from the bracket. Installation is the reverse of removal.

Does a 99 Mitsubishi diamante have an egr solenoid or just the egr valve. If it does have the solenoid where is it related to the valve?

Yes, the Diamante has an EGR solenoid. On any Mitsubishi, if the car has an egr valve, it has a solenoid to operate the valve. Just follow the vacuum line from the valve and it will go to the solenoid. There may be another one way valve between the valve and the solenoid, though. The solenoid is electronic.

How do you change the EGR solenoid valve in a 94 Infiniti G20?

The valve is located on the intake manifold support under intake manifold. It is attached to the bracket by a single stud and a 10mm nut. It has a single connector containing two wires. The connector has wire clip that you must release to remove the connector. The solenoid has three vacuum lines connected to it. There is a single hose on one end and two on the other. The hoses connect to metal tubes the go to the egr valve. There is a gold anodized bracket that holds the solenoid together. It is easier to access from under the vehicle.

What is direct acting solenoid valve?

A direct acting solenoid valve is one in which the action of the solenoid alone switches the valve gate. Most solenoid valves are "piloted", which means that a relatively small solenoid valve is used to allow pressurized air to actuate the valve gate mechanism. Because the solenoid does all of the work in a direct acting valve, the solenoid must therefore be larger than that of a piloted valve in order to generate the switching force. Piloted solenoid valves have the advantage of being more compact and consuming less current than a direct acting solenoid valve. Direct acting solenoid valves are useful when switching low pressure fluids.
